[edit] Information on Reuben KarnesBedford County Marriage bonds has: Oct. 12, 1808; Reubin Kerns & Polly B owles; John Boyle, Surety. F. Landis Weaver writes: Reuben Karnes was born about 1784 in Bedford County, Virginia. His age w as under 21 in 1804, and over 25 in 1810 in 1804. He died in Jun 1835 i n Bedford County, Virginia. (Will Book 9, page 50). He was probably bur ied in NW Bedford County, Virginia. He was mentioned as being under-aged in his father's will of Nov 1803, a nd was shown as over the age of 25 on the 1810 Census. He apparently li ved all of his life in Bedford County, Virginia. Reuben bought 103 acre s of land, joining the northern corner of his father's old 165-acre tra ct, on 13 Feb 1817 (Book 5, page 145). He apparently mortgaged it to Sa lly Boyle, and bought it back on 4 Nov 1823 (Book 18, page 160). Then h e sold it for one dollar to James Welch (a cousin by marriage) on 24 Oc t 1828 (Book 21, page 197). It's difficult to figure out the legal arra ngements that Reuben made regarding his land, but it is believed that h e continued to live there, or very nearby. Reuben married Polly Boyle (daughter of John) on 12 Oct 1808. Consents w ere not required, which indicates that he was over the age of 21, and s he was over the age of 18. Reuben & Polly had 4 daughters: Adeline Mine rva Welch, Rebecca T. Vasser, Permelia Frances Vasser, and Harriet Jane K arnes (married surnames shown). Reuben & Polly's family appeared in Bed ford County on the 1810-30 Census. Due to the varying ages of their dau ghters, only 3 were shown on any one Census record. Reuben died in Bedford County in June 1835. His will (Book 9, page 50) n amed his daughters. Polly died in Bedford County in March 1864. All of t heir children are believed to have remained in Bedford County, Virginia . |
